1熟练掌握 Java 语言以及面向对象设计思想,具有扎实的 Java 编程功底和编码规范
2熟练使用 Spring、SpringMVC、MyBatis、MyBatis Plus、Spring boot 等框架。
3熟悉使用 Oracle,MySQL,SqlServer 等关系型数据库;以及了解 Linux 常用命令
4熟悉 Tomcat、Nginx、RabbitMQ、maven 等中间件
5熟悉使用 sprintsecuity 安全框架以及 redis 数据缓存
6.熟悉使用 websocket,tcp 通信协议
7掌握 idea 开发工具
8.前端熟悉html,js,jquery,以及vue.js等
项目名称:可视化实时指挥调度平台
项目架构:B/S
项目描述:可视化实时指挥平台可以将现场图像、视频等数据进行实时传输,使指挥决策者能够全面了解现场情况, 做出准确指挥决策。
项目技术:mysql,springboot,websocket,tcp,token,vue,nginx,maven
硬件:4g执法记录仪,数据采集工作站
项目模块:
1登录:系统登录,人员登录
2.实时调度
3.证据中心:文件管理,轨迹查看,报警记录,统计分析,文件标签
4.协同作战:任务管理,电子围栏,集群对讲
5.智能ai:人脸库,车牌库
6.服务器管理:服务器配置,采集站配置
7.系统管理:单位管理,人员管理,设备管理,角色管理,用户管理
8.websocekt数据传输
责任:本人在项目中负责整个后端模块接口开发,并与设备进行websocket数据传输确保设备实时在线
项目架构:B/S 项目描述:可视化实时指挥平台可以将现场图像、视频等数据进行实时传输,使指挥决策者能够全面了解现场情况, 做出准确指挥决策。 项目技术:mysql,springboot,websocket,tcp,token,vue,nginx,maven 硬件:4g执法记
项目介绍 : 1.负责后端服务器的设计与开发,确保系统的稳定性和高效性。 2.实现了基于B/S架构的web管理系统,便于远程监控和管理装备柜。 3.开发了C/S架构的应用程序客户端,以满足不同用户的操作需求。 4.集成物联网技术,实现装备柜与其他智能设备的互联互通。